Output 43900bf64348eded9c57543634311c842829c68e4cc175f7cac9238a198c3a2a:8

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b8a65b9276609c9740fb70950f71b7413dd4e4 OP_EQUAL
address
39n8b7vqxDXcCGnRnqpuvEzkTsz7xUvHyz
transaction
43900bf64348eded9c57543634311c842829c68e4cc175f7cac9238a198c3a2a
spent
true